LG Chem has started construction of its first advanced recycling plant in South Korea using HydroPRS technology from Mura. Construction of this first site is expected to be completed by the end of 2024, with the site fully operational in 2025, producing up to 20,000 tonnes of recycled hydrocarbons annually. HydroPRS is an advanced recycling process which uses supercritical steam to convert waste plastics back into petrochemical feedstocks for use in the manufacture of new plastic products.
